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-18 Thread Itamar Heim
On 02/18/2014 04:55 PM, Shahar Havivi wrote: On 18.02.14 17:56, Tejesh M wrote: I want to assign random password for Administrator & IP address through API, as we did for Linux OS using Cloud-init. You suppose to run it via the API as you run regular VM (start action) and set the values in the

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-18 Thread Shahar Havivi
On 18.02.14 17:56, Tejesh M wrote: > I want to assign random password for Administrator & IP address through > API, as we did for Linux OS using Cloud-init. You suppose to run it via the API as you run regular VM (start action) and set the values in the body: do a PUT method to: http://[HOST]:[POR

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-18 Thread Tejesh M
I want to assign random password for Administrator & IP address through API, as we did for Linux OS using Cloud-init. On Tue, Feb 18, 2014 at 5:45 PM, Shahar Havivi wrote: > On 18.02.14 17:27, Tejesh M wrote: > > Yes, I tried that, it asks for Domain Name and Username & Password for > that > >

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-18 Thread Shahar Havivi
On 18.02.14 17:27, Tejesh M wrote: > Yes, I tried that, it asks for Domain Name and Username & Password for that > domain to join. But no option to reset the Admin password. What do you mean by reset? Do you want to have no admin password? > > > On Tue, Feb 18, 2014 at 5:20 PM, Shahar Havivi wr

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-18 Thread Tejesh M
Yes, I tried that, it asks for Domain Name and Username & Password for that domain to join. But no option to reset the Admin password. On Tue, Feb 18, 2014 at 5:20 PM, Shahar Havivi wrote: > On 18.02.14 17:08, Tejesh M wrote: > > I tried sysprep through web admin, but it shows only Domain name

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-18 Thread Shahar Havivi
On 18.02.14 17:08, Tejesh M wrote: > I tried sysprep through web admin, but it shows only Domain name and > alternate username & password. There is no option to reset Administrator > Password. Please try via the Run-Once, You need to attach Floppy in "Boot Options" and set it to "[Sysprep]" Then yo

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-18 Thread Tejesh M
I tried sysprep through web admin, but it shows only Domain name and alternate username & password. There is no option to reset Administrator Password. On Tue, Feb 18, 2014 at 1:01 PM, Itamar Heim wrote: > On 02/18/2014 07:27 AM, Tejesh M wrote: > >> Oh did silly mistake.. didn't check above 8

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-17 Thread Itamar Heim
On 02/18/2014 07:27 AM, Tejesh M wrote: Oh did silly mistake.. didn't check above 8 characters. Its working. I want to set Adminstrator Password for windows through API. does cloud-init supports windows sysprep? or I need to install some other component? you can use windows sysprep, which ovir

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-17 Thread Tejesh M
Oh did silly mistake.. didn't check above 8 characters. Its working. I want to set Adminstrator Password for windows through API. does cloud-init supports windows sysprep? or I need to install some other component? On Mon, Feb 17, 2014 at 7:42 PM, Shahar Havivi wrote: > On 17.02.14 18:25, Te

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-17 Thread Shahar Havivi
On 17.02.14 18:25, Tejesh M wrote: > Thanks.. thats solved the issue. but now when i try to login with password > i set through API using cloud-init. OS (RHEL 6) is asking me to assign new > password & what ever i give weak or strong password, it is not accepting. try more then 8 characters with up

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-17 Thread Tejesh M
Thanks.. thats solved the issue. but now when i try to login with password i set through API using cloud-init. OS (RHEL 6) is asking me to assign new password & what ever i give weak or strong password, it is not accepting. On Mon, Feb 17, 2014 at 11:50 AM, Itamar Heim wrote: > On 02/17/2014

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-16 Thread Itamar Heim
On 02/17/2014 08:16 AM, Tejesh M wrote: It's cloud-init-0.6.3-0.12.bzr532.el6.noarch.rpm installed on guest. you need at least 0.7.2 iirc, its available in .el6.5 On Fri, Feb 14, 2014 at 9:18 PM, Itamar Heim mailto:ih...@redhat.com>> wrote: On 02/14/2014 03:07 PM, Tejesh M wrote:

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-16 Thread Tejesh M
It's cloud-init-0.6.3-0.12.bzr532.el6.noarch.rpm installed on guest. On Fri, Feb 14, 2014 at 9:18 PM, Itamar Heim wrote: > On 02/14/2014 03:07 PM, Tejesh M wrote: > >> Thanks, now i could see the cloud-init option in Run Once.. I did >> selected "Other Linux" instead of exact Linux flavor. And

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-14 Thread Shahar Havivi
On 14.02.14 17:48, Itamar Heim wrote: > On 02/14/2014 03:07 PM, Tejesh M wrote: > >Thanks, now i could see the cloud-init option in Run Once.. I did > >selected "Other Linux" instead of exact Linux flavor. And sorry, instead > >of Reply All, i clicked on Reply and sent that mail. > > shahar - any

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-14 Thread Itamar Heim
On 02/14/2014 03:07 PM, Tejesh M wrote: Thanks, now i could see the cloud-init option in Run Once.. I did selected "Other Linux" instead of exact Linux flavor. And sorry, instead of Reply All, i clicked on Reply and sent that mail. shahar - any reason 'other linux' doesn't have cloud-init? soun

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-14 Thread Juan Hernandez
On 02/14/2014 03:28 PM, Tejesh M wrote: > Tried with disabling the ISO Domain, still it is check for network > instead of mount the CDROM > > and my RHEV version is RHEV-H 6.5-20140121.0.el6ev > Ok, that is the same version I'm testing with. Please try to connect to the hypervisor and see what

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-14 Thread Tejesh M
Tried with disabling the ISO Domain, still it is check for network instead of mount the CDROM and my RHEV version is RHEV-H 6.5-20140121.0.el6ev On Fri, Feb 14, 2014 at 7:29 PM, Juan Hernandez wrote: > On 02/14/2014 02:48 PM, Tejesh M wrote: > > CDROM is attached, but it is mounting the defaul

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-14 Thread Juan Hernandez
On 02/14/2014 02:48 PM, Tejesh M wrote: > CDROM is attached, but it is mounting the default iso from ISO Domain. > Do you have that default CDROM explicitly attached to the VM? If so then you need to detach it. To be absolutely sure that there isn't any CDROMs from the ISO domain attached to the

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-14 Thread Tejesh M
CDROM is attached, but it is mounting the default iso from ISO Domain. On Fri, Feb 14, 2014 at 6:54 PM, Juan Hernandez wrote: > On 02/14/2014 02:07 PM, Tejesh M wrote: > > Thanks, now i could see the cloud-init option in Run Once.. I did > > selected "Other Linux" instead of exact Linux flavor.

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-14 Thread Juan Hernandez
On 02/14/2014 02:07 PM, Tejesh M wrote: > Thanks, now i could see the cloud-init option in Run Once.. I did > selected "Other Linux" instead of exact Linux flavor. And sorry, instead > of Reply All, i clicked on Reply and sent that mail. > > Now, when i start VM from Run Once with Cloud-init optio

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-14 Thread Shahar Havivi
On 14.02.14 18:37, Tejesh M wrote: > Thanks, now i could see the cloud-init option in Run Once.. I did selected > "Other Linux" instead of exact Linux flavor. And sorry, instead of Reply > All, i clicked on Reply and sent that mail. > > Now, when i start VM from Run Once with Cloud-init options li

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-14 Thread Juan Hernandez
On 02/14/2014 12:27 PM, Tejesh M wrote: > Here is the list: > > [root@rhevm ~]# rpm -qa 'rhevm*' > > rhevm-lib-3.3.0-0.46.el6ev.noarch > rhevm-setup-3.3.0-0.46.el6ev.noarch > rhevm-spice-client-x86-msi-3.3-8.el6_5.noarch > rhevm-branding-rhev-3.3.0-1.5.el6ev.noarch > rhevm-restapi-3.3.0-0.46.el6e

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-14 Thread Gianluca Cecchi
On Fri, Feb 14, 2014 at 11:22 AM, Juan Hernandez wrote: > On 02/14/2014 11:03 AM, Tejesh M wrote: >> In the two screenshots which i shared earlier, in that "No Cloud-Init >> 2.png" is "Run Once" screenshot, it has only 4 options, >> >> i. Boot Options >> ii. Host >> iii. Display Protocol >> iv. Cu

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-14 Thread Juan Hernandez
hat.com>> > > <mailto:jhern...@redhat.com <mailto:jhern...@redhat.com> > <mailto:jhern...@redhat.com <mailto:jhern...@redhat.com>>> > > > >>>> <mailto:jhern...@redhat.com > <mailto:jhern...@redhat.com> <mailto:jher

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-14 Thread Juan Hernandez
; usersData.getUsers().add(userData); >> > >>>> CloudInit cloudData = new CloudInit(); >> > >>>> cloudData.setUsers(usersData); >> > >>>> >> > >>>> Initialization initData =

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-14 Thread Tejesh M
t; > > >>>> cloudData.setUsers(usersData); > > > >>>> > > > >>>> Initialization initData = new Initialization(); > > > >>>> initData.setCloudInit(cloudData); > &

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-14 Thread Juan Hernandez
t; >>>> actionData.setVm(vmDataForStart); > > >>>> > > >>>> // Send the request to start the VM to the server: > > >>>> api.getVMs().get(vmName).start(actionData); > >

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-13 Thread Juan Hernandez
gt;>>> VM vmDataForStart = new VM(); > >>>> vmDataForStart.setInitialization(initData); > >>>> Action actionData = new Action(); > >>>> actionData.setVm(vmDataForStart); > >

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-13 Thread Tejesh M
e("root"); > >>>> userData.setPassword(password); > >>>> Users usersData = new Users(); > >>>> usersData.getUsers().add(userData); > >>>> CloudInit cloudData = new CloudInit(); > >>>&

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-13 Thread Juan Hernandez
>> >>>> Initialization initData = new Initialization(); >>>> initData.setCloudInit(cloudData); >>>> VM vmDataForStart = new VM(); >>>> vmDataForStart.setInitialization(initData); >>>>

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-13 Thread Shahar Havivi
Data = new Action(); > > > actionData.setVm(vmDataForStart); > > > > > > // Send the request to start the VM to the server: > > > api.getVMs().get(vmName).start(actionData); > > > System.out.println("Afte

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-13 Thread Tejesh M
t; Thanks & Regards, > > Tejesh > > > > > > > > On Thu, Feb 13, 2014 at 2:26 PM, Juan Hernandez > <mailto:jhern...@redhat.com>> wrote: > > > > On 02/13/2014 09:29 AM, Shahar Havivi wrote: > > > On 13.02.14 00:59, Oved Ourfalli wrote:

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-13 Thread Juan Hernandez
api.getVMs().get(vmName).start(actionData); >> System.out.println("After : >> "+api.getVMs().get(vmName).getStatus()); >> /*****************End Customize VM*/ >> >> >> >> Thanks & Regards,

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-13 Thread Juan Hernandez
>>> From: "Shahar Havivi" <mailto:shah...@redhat.com>> > >>> To: users@ovirt.org <mailto:users@ovirt.org> > >>> Cc: "Juan Antonio Hernandez Fernandez" <mailto:jhern...@redhat.com>>, rhevm-...@lists

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-13 Thread Sven Kieske
: >>> On 13.02.14 00:59, Oved Ourfalli wrote: >>>> >>>> >>>> - Original Message - >>>>> From: "Shahar Havivi" >>>>> To: users@ovirt.org >>>>> Cc: "Juan Antonio Hernandez Fernandez" ,

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-13 Thread Tejesh M
vi wrote: > > On 13.02.14 00:59, Oved Ourfalli wrote: > >> > >> > >> - Original Message - > >>> From: "Shahar Havivi" > >>> To: users@ovirt.org > >>> Cc: "Juan Antonio Hernandez Fernandez" , >

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-13 Thread Juan Hernandez
gt;> rhevm-...@lists.fedorahosted.org, "Tejesh M" >>> >>> Sent: Wednesday, February 12, 2014 11:22:20 PM >>> Subject: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K >>> >>> On 12.02.14 22:55, Itamar Heim wrote: >

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-13 Thread Shahar Havivi
; > > Sent: Wednesday, February 12, 2014 11:22:20 PM > > Subject: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K > > > > On 12.02.14 22:55, Itamar Heim wrote: > > > On 02/12/2014 03:14 PM, Tejesh M wrote: > > > >Hi, > > > > >

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-13 Thread Sven Kieske
Yes, there is REST support, but for ovirt < 3.4 the JSON submitted data format is incomplete, this is just documented in a BZ somewhere. So in order to pass all data successfully, you need to use XML. (especially for the root password) JSON should be supported from 3.4 but I didn't test this myse

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-12 Thread Oved Ourfalli
- Original Message - > From: "Shahar Havivi" > To: users@ovirt.org > Cc: "Juan Antonio Hernandez Fernandez" , > rhevm-...@lists.fedorahosted.org, "Tejesh M" > > Sent: Wednesday, February 12, 2014 11:22:20 PM > Subject: Re: [Users]

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-12 Thread Shahar Havivi
On 12.02.14 22:55, Itamar Heim wrote: > On 02/12/2014 03:14 PM, Tejesh M wrote: > >Hi, > > > >Can anyone share sample code on how to assign IP address to guest os & > >changing the root password while creating VM from Template using Java SDK? Hi Tejesh, You should start here: http://www.ovirt.org/A

Re: [Users] [rhevm-api] Assign IP address to VM using Java SDK

2014-02-12 Thread Itamar Heim
On 02/12/2014 03:14 PM, Tejesh M wrote: Hi, Can anyone share sample code on how to assign IP address to guest os & changing the root password while creating VM from Template using Java SDK? -- Thanks & Regards Lucky ___ rhevm-api mailing list rhevm